    When you encounter issues that you suspect might be related to iOSCISABELLASC SEFO SCSOZLERISC, or any other complex system function, a methodical approach to troubleshooting is key. First, ensure your device is running the latest version of iOS. Apple frequently releases updates that address bugs, improve performance, and introduce new security measures. If you're experiencing a problem, a software update is often the first and simplest solution. Secondly, try restarting your device. A simple reboot can resolve many temporary glitches by clearing out memory and resetting background processes. If the issue persists, consider backing up your device and then performing a factory reset. This is a more drastic step, but it can often resolve deep-seated software conflicts. Remember to back up your data first! For more specific issues potentially linked to iOSCISABELLASC SEFO SCSOZLERISC, consider checking Apple's official support documentation or reputable tech forums. Users often share their experiences and solutions for unique problems. If you’re a developer, delving into Apple’s developer resources and forums is essential. They often provide detailed explanations of specific frameworks, APIs, and potential issues. Best practices for maintaining a healthy iOS device include managing storage space effectively, being mindful of app permissions, and regularly reviewing your privacy settings.
